What is Zone 5b?

Zone 5b is a climate region in the United States that experiences cold winters with temperatures ranging from -15ยฐF to -10ยฐF. This region is ideal for growing a variety of plants, but it’s important to know when to start your seeds to ensure a successful growing season.

When Should You Start Your Seeds?

According to the zone 5b seed starting calendar, you should start your seeds indoors 6-8 weeks before the last expected frost date. In this region, the last frost date is typically around May 15th.

What Plants Should You Start?

You can start a variety of plants indoors during this time, including tomatoes, peppers, broccoli, and cabbage. These plants will be ready to transplant outdoors once the weather warms up and the risk of frost has passed.

Tips for Starting Seeds Indoors

Starting seeds indoors can be a bit tricky, but with the right tools and techniques, you can set yourself up for success. Here are a few tips to keep in mind:

  • Use a high-quality seed starting mix
  • Provide adequate light with grow lights or a sunny windowsill
  • Keep the soil moist but not too wet
  • Use a fan to promote air circulation and prevent mold growth

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: Can I start seeds outdoors in zone 5b?

A: It’s not recommended to start seeds directly outdoors in zone 5b due to the risk of frost and colder temperatures. Starting seeds indoors allows you to control the environment and provide the optimal conditions for germination and growth.

Q: Should I use a heating mat to start my seeds?

A: While a heating mat can help speed up germination, it’s not always necessary. As long as you keep your seeds in a warm, bright location, they should germinate just fine.

Q: How often should I water my seedlings?

A: It’s important to keep the soil moist but not too wet. Water when the soil feels dry to the touch, but be careful not to overwater as this can lead to mold growth.
